3.2 Promoting Interdisciplinary Development
- Particle Physics: Topological defects (e.g., magnetic monopoles, cosmic strings) are related to the structure of elementary particles.
- Cosmology: Topological phase transitions in the early universe can be studied through vortex models.
- Condensed Matter Physics: Topological Materials provide a unified theoretical framework for novel electronic states.
